They will work to rule, starting today.
The Ontario English Catholic Teachers Association will start taking administrative job action.
This means union members won’t write comments on report cards and they won’t participate in standardized testing.
This will affect English Catholic teachers across Niagara, and the rest of the province.
The union says the strike action will continue until a tentative agreement is reached with the province.
It also says further strike action, including a full withdrawal of services, may be necessary if the government doesn’t budge.
